A starboard side view, taken from just ahead of the beam, of the Canadian Pacific Steamships cruise ship Montclare (1922) at anchor in an unknown location. Her starboard anchor is deployed and she is dressed overall. An accommodation ladder is rigged at the aft shell door and a large number of small local craft are clustered in the vicinity. This may be at one of the Atlantic Islands.
